Stock market today: The Indian stock market's key indices, Sensex and Nifty 50, maintained a stance of cautious trading on Tuesday, May 21st, as the majority of stocks experienced declines.

The Sensex concluded the day with a marginal decrease of 53 points, or 0.07 percent, settling at 73,953.31, while the Nifty 50 saw a slight uptick of 27 points, or 0.12 percent, closing at 22,529.05.

According to data on the BSE website, the market capitalization of companies listed on the BSE, reached a new high of $5 trillion, surpassing the $5 trillion mark for the first time this year and increasing by over $633 billion from the starting of this year.

“The $5 trillion market cap for BSE listed companies is a major milestone that reflects the sustained momentum of the Indian stock market. It is important to understand that this landmark has been achieved when the market is almost flat trading in a range. This means the contribution to the up move in market cap has come from the broader market. PSUs have contributed significantly to this achievement," said V K Vijayakumar, Chief Investment Strategist, Geojit Financial Services.

Trade setup for Wednesday

On the Nifty outlook, Rupak De, Senior Technical Analyst, LKP Securities, said, "The index remained within the range of 22,400 and 22,600. Strong put writing at 22,400 and 22,500 might provide support to the Nifty. On the higher end, a decisive move above 22,600 might induce a rally towards 22,800 in the near term. Till then the index might continue consolidating as long as it remains within the range of 22,400 to 22,600."

On the Bank Nifty outlook, Kunal Shah, Senior Technical & Derivative Analyst at LKP Securities, said, "The Bank Nifty index failed to surpass the mark of 48,400, where the 20DMA is placed. A break above this level will lead to a fresh move on the upside. The lower-end support is placed at 48,000, where the highest open interest is built up on the put side. The index needs to break these levels decisively on either side to have trending moves in the near term."
